admin 管理员组

文章数量: 887021


2024年2月28日发(作者:python做后端)

如何在Excel中使用IF函数进行多个列日期判断和计算并忽略某些条件

Microsoft Excel是一款功能强大的电子表格软件,可用于处理和分析数据。在Excel中,IF函数是一个常用的逻辑函数,用于根据指定的条件对数据进行判断和计算。本文将介绍如何在Excel中使用IF函数进行多个列日期判断和计算,并忽略某些条件。

在实际工作中,我们经常需要对不同列的日期进行判断和计算。例如,在某个销售数据表中,我们可能需要根据订单日期、发货日期和付款日期来判断订单的状态,并计算订单的交付时长。以下将分别介绍如何使用IF函数进行日期判断和计算。

首先,我们需要了解IF函数的基本语法。IF函数的语法如下:

```

IF(条件, 值为真时的结果, 值为假时的结果)

```

其中,条件是一个逻辑表达式,用于进行判断。如果条件为真,则返回值为真时的结果;如果条件为假,则返回值为假时的结果。

1. 利用IF函数进行日期判断

为了简化例子,假设我们有一份销售数据表,其中A列为订单日期,B列为发货日期,C列为付款日期。我们希望通过判断这三个日期

来确定订单的状态,如果订单已经发货并且付款成功,则状态为“已完成”,否则状态为“未完成”。

在D列中输入以下公式:

```

=IF(AND(B2<>"", C2<>""), "已完成", "未完成")

```

上述公式中,AND函数用于判断发货日期和付款日期是否都不为空,如果是,则返回“已完成”,否则返回“未完成”。

2. 利用IF函数进行日期计算

利用IF函数,我们还可以对不同列的日期进行计算。例如,我们希望计算订单的交付时长,即发货日期与订单日期之间的天数差。

在E列中输入以下公式:

```

=IF(B2="", "", B2 - A2)

```

上述公式中,IF函数首先判断发货日期是否为空,如果为空,则返回空值;否则,返回发货日期与订单日期之间的天数差。通过这种方式,我们可以忽略某些条件,只计算满足特定条件的日期之差。

总结:

使用IF函数可以方便地进行多个列日期的判断和计算,并且可以根据需要忽略某些条件。IF函数的灵活运用,为我们在Excel中进行复杂的数据处理提供了便利。通过学习和理解IF函数的使用方法,我们可以更有效地利用Excel进行数据分析和求解问题。

注意:在使用IF函数时,需注意逻辑表达式的编写,确保条件的准确性。另外,当使用多个IF函数嵌套时,要注意嵌套的层数不要过多,以免公式过于繁琐和难以维护。在实际应用中,可以考虑使用其他函数或工具来简化复杂的逻辑判断和计算。


本文标签: 函数 进行 判断